Description

Definition. Bitcoin Sharpe Signal is a machine-learning long-entry signal for BTC, trained on on-chain data with the design goal of minimizing downside risk while capturing rising trends and enhancing risk-adjusted returns.

Technical. The model output is a confidence score rendered as a color ramp, with green indicating the highest confidence and orange through red indicating reduced confidence. The signal is refreshed daily at 04:00 UTC, finalizing the previous day's timestamp. The standard version carries a one-day lag. Disclosed foundational inputs include Percent of Entities in Profit and Short Term Holder SOPR.

Interpretation. Readings above 0.5 have historically been associated with improved risk-adjusted Bitcoin performance.

This is the Point-in-Time (PiT) variant of Bitcoin Sharpe Signal. PiT metrics are strictly append-only and their history is immutable. The historic data does not necessarily reflect the best current knowledge, but the information at the time when a data point was first computed. PiT metrics are ideal candidates for applications in model backtesting and related quantitative purposes. Read our article on PiT metrics for more information.
